DJ, what else besides the Seahorses are going in there that require lighting? If no high-light demanding corals/clams I would go DIY using a 5" x 36" or so heatsink with no more than 36 LED's (8 cool whites, 4 warm whites, 12 royal blues, 8 blues, 2 greens and 2 reds) this combination would make all colors POP! With lots of Gorgonians and Zoanthids would look like a Avitar set.

Just to give you a reference point, I was in a very similar situation to yours. I didn't have a ton of experience in LED (and am certainly still learning), but have also chose to go the DIY route. I worked with Mike through RapidLed.com and have been really happy with the service. A big factor for me was that they carried the solderless kits. So for my standard AGA 75 gallon tank, I am getting a couple of the 24 LED solderless dimmable kits (for my Apex controller) that will mount on 6"x20" heat sinks. This will let me grow the full range of corals, though since I am starting out, I plan to go for the easy stuff and as my experience grows, tackle some of the harder ones. For my setup, it was $550 for everything, and this will be all solderless. If you can put together Legos, these kits should be a breeze. You may be fine with the soldering iron, and if so, you'll save even more.
